Confirming the incident to Pulse.com.gh, the Public Relations Officer of the Ashanti Regional Police, ASP Yusif Mohammed Tanko said the incident happened around 5:45pm after the constable, Dennis Makagor had attempted to forcibly enter the residence of the Ashanti Regional Police Commander, DCOP Nathan Kofi Boakye to speak to him.
ASP Tanko said after the constable was told by the guard that DCOP Kofi Boakye was not around, "he took offence, pounced on the body of the guard, tried to take his rifle from him, but the body guard managed to extricate himself from him, and when the guy was still trying to take the rifle from him, he shot him in the leg."
Meanwhile, the police suspect that Constable Makagor was mentally deranged.
He is currently on admission at the Komfo Anokye Teaching Hospital.
